Bad Company
SYNOPSIS
Delphine is fifteen. Her life is completely empty. And then, suddenly, it seems completely full: she has a lover, Laurent, a friend, Olivia, and everything that goes with them—sex, music, the impression of no longer being alone, of constantly moving ahead, of existing. But hanging out with this “bad crowd” leads Delphine into the throes of passion as she discovers that, at age fifteen, she’ll do anything for love
